Backstory:
U2 have been criticized by environmentalists, as well as David Byrne, for their mammoth 360 Tour, which is leaving a large, undeniable carbon footprint. The Edge has been defending the tour, claiming that U2 will offset the environmental impact. He isn't saying how.
Headlines:
U2 Hits Back In Row Over 360 Tour Carbon Footprint
U2 Guitarist Defends Charges Against Environmental Damage
The Edge Annoyed By U2 Carbon Criticism
Verdict:
U2 waited too long to respond. Once everyone had moved on, U2 returned the story to the news by releasing belated statements. Not a black eye, but a bruise.

Backstory:
U2 played a stadium show in Zagreb last month. The pitch had to be replaced, and visiting Scottish team Hearts are concerned over possible injuries ahead of their match.
Headlines:
Laszlo Fears For Hearts Players As U2 Render Zagreb Pitch A Hazard
Stuck In A Moment They Can't Get Out Of
Verdict:
Not everything is U2's fault. Blame the stadium, not the rock!
Backstory:
U2 recently played three hometown shows at Dublin's Croke Park. Fans loved it. Nearby residents complained about the neighborhood invasion.
Headlines:
U2 Rake It In, But Not All Are Pleased
U2 Confound The Doubters To Blow Away Croke Park
Verdict:
Sometimes life isn't fair. The residents complaining about the inconvenience of huge crowds need to chill. Nothing wrong with being successful.
